Understanding the NYSC Timetable

1. Orientation Camp Dates:

The timetable kick-starts with the orientation camp, where fresh graduates gather for a 21-day program. Key activities include registration, skill acquisition training, and cultural exchange sessions. Make sure to note the dates and venue assigned to your batch.

2. Primary Assignment Posting:

Following the orientation, graduates receive their primary assignment postings. This phase is crucial as it determines the organization or school where you’ll serve. Stay updated to ensure a smooth transition.

3. Community Development Service (CDS):

The CDS phase involves community service activities. Understand your group and project assignments, and actively participate to contribute positively to the community.

4. Passing Out Parade (POP):

The conclusion of the NYSC year is marked by the Passing Out Parade. It’s essential to be aware of the dates and details surrounding this event as it signifies the completion of your service year.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: Can I change my primary assignment location?

A1: While changes are rare, you can apply for relocation under specific circumstances. Consult your NYSC officials for guidance.

Q2: What happens during the orientation camp?

A2: The orientation camp involves various activities, including registration, medical checks, and skill acquisition programs.

Q3: How can I get my call-up letter?

A3: Your call-up letter is available on the NYSC portal. Simply log in and download it before the orientation camp begins.
